Output ed99c4baa8f04545d0bb631f228423d886ad1191528ae78f4e844c994d811e73:0

value
135066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ea13fde39fe082dcdeb3bb1b9c8926865e068ea6 OP_EQUAL
address
3P2hzUzqndkYHrqb32Tx5dWr8webQzDZQH
transaction
ed99c4baa8f04545d0bb631f228423d886ad1191528ae78f4e844c994d811e73
spent
true